Broadcom is a semiconductor company based in San Josรฉ, California. The company was the semiconductor product division of Hewlett-Packard and later Agilent prior to its spin-off.
According to Broadcom's latest financial reports the company has a price-to-book ratio of 14.4.
The price-to-book ratio is a way to measure how much the stock market thinks a company is worth compared to how much the company says its assets are worth on paper.
